TY - JOUR T1 - Juvenile spring eruption: a seasonal rash JF - Archives of disease in childhood - Education & practice edition JO - Arch Dis Child Educ Pract Ed DO - 10.1136/archdischild-2021-322696 SP - edpract-2021-322696 AU - Claire Hope AU - Gita Modgil Y1 - 2021/12/14 UR - http://ep.bmj.com/content/early/2021/12/13/archdischild-2021-322696.abstract N2 - A boy aged 14 years presented with itchy small red lumps on the helix of each ear the morning after playing a preseason cricket match for his local club (figures 1 and 2). These lumps evolved into blisters then crusted and healed without scarring over a 10-day period. He was systemically well with no temperatures or other skin lesions, but found to have mild cervical lymphadenopathy. The lumps were noted to recur the following year at the … ER -
